Enable job alerts via email!

Senior Systems Developer

Venor

Halifax

Remote

CAD 80,000 - 110,000

Full time

3 days ago
Be an early applicant

Job summary

A cybersecurity company in Halifax or remote is seeking a Senior Systems Developer responsible for building and maintaining security software. The ideal candidate will have significant experience with Linux systems, networking, and Python. They will design applications that enhance security measures and ensure software quality through unit testing. The position offers a flexible working environment, health benefits, and three weeks of vacation, alongside a culture of inclusivity.

Benefits

Health, Dental, and Professional coverage
Flexible working hours
Three weeks' vacation
Generous home office allowance
Paid holiday per month

Qualifications

  • 5+ years of Linux systems administration experience.
  • Proven experience configuring Linux firewalls, especially nft.
  • Several years of Python development experience.

Responsibilities

  • Designing and developing software to translate information into firewall rules.
  • Configuring and managing Linux firewalls and routing tables.
  • Conducting unit testing in Python to ensure software quality.

Skills

Linux systems administration
Python development
Networking
Unit testing
Firewall configuration

Education

Bachelor's degree in Computer Science

Tools

Docker
PostgreSQL
RabbitMQ

Job description

Job Description

Job Description

Senior Systems Developer

Halifax, NS or Remote (Canada) | Permanent | Software Development

Venor is proud to partner with Byos in their search for a Senior Systems Developer to join their growing team.

Byos' microsegmentation platform delivers next-level endpoint security, providing invisibility, isolation, and secure access without exposing devices or risking data leakage. Built for Zero Trust networking and compatible with diverse devices and environments, Byos technology powers secure operations in industries like Critical Infrastructure, Manufacturing, Defense, Energy, and Financial Services. From protecting plant floor machinery to safeguarding individual laptops, the work you'll do here has real-world impact on the security of systems people rely on every day.

The Senior Systems Developer will play a critical role in building and maintaining the software that powers Byos' security infrastructure. This is a highly technical role requiring deep expertise in Linux systems, networking, and Python development. Reporting to the CTO, you will design, develop, and optimize system-level applications that interface with networking, security, and database components, directly impacting the performance, security, and scalability of Byos products.

What you'll be doing :

Designing and developing software to translate information into firewall rules, routing table updates, and database models.

Configuring and managing Linux firewalls (nftables, iptables) and routing tables.

Building functional, extensible interfaces between Byos infrastructure components.

Collaborating with cross-functional teams to decompose complex requirements into manageable deliverables.

Conducting unit testing in Python to ensure software quality and maintainability.

Documenting technical decisions, designs, and implementation details clearly and thoroughly.

Applying strong software engineering discipline and best practices to all development activities.

What we are looking for :

Bachelor's degree in Computer Science or equivalent experience.

5+ years of Linux systems administration experience, including strong command-line proficiency (nft, awk, sed, ip, ifconfig).

Proven hands-on experience configuring Linux firewalls, specifically using nft; experience with iptables is an asset.

Deep understanding of firewalls, routing tables, and network traffic management (conceptual knowledge prioritized over tool-specific expertise).

Several years of Python development experience with strong fundamentals (non-web framework focus).

Unit testing experience in Python.

Strong understanding of software engineering principles and system design.

Excellent written and spoken English communication skills.

Assets (experience with any of the following) :

dbus.

RabbitMQ, STOMP, AMQP 0.9.1.

PostgreSQL, SQLAlchemy, Alembic.

OpenVPN, OpenSSL.

Docker.

What's in it for you :

Office in Volta – Canada's East Coast Innovation Hub.

Health, Dental, and Professional coverage for you and your family start immediately.

Flexible working hours / environment with generous home office allowance.

One paid holiday per month + ‘Holiday Shutdown' between Christmas and New Years.

Three weeks' vacation (in addition to holiday shut down).

At Venor and Byos, we embrace a culture of belonging in the workplace. No matter who you are, where you're from, how you think, what you believe in, or who you love, we welcome your application. We all come from different backgrounds and walks of life, bringing unique perspectives and experiences. We encourage applications from 2SLGBTQ+, Black, Indigenous, and People of Colour (BIPOC), women, newcomers to Canada, and people with disabilities.

To apply, please forward your resume to Vanessa Rodriguez Garcia via

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.

Similar jobs